#61518c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#61518c is composed of 38% red, 31.8% green and 54.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 30.7% cyan, 42.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 45.1% black. It has a hue angle of 256.3 degrees, a saturation of 26.7% and a lightness of 43.3%. #61518c color hex could be obtained by blending #c2a2ff with #000019.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

● #61518c color description : Mostly desaturated dark violet.
#61518c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#61518c has RGB values of R:97, G:81, B:140 and CMYK values of C:0.31, M:0.42, Y:0, K:0.45. Its decimal value is 6377868.

Shades and Tints of #61518c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020203 is the darkest color, while #f7f6fa is the lightest one.
